Summary

A visual survey of some of our world's rare and endangered mammals. It features photographs of 60 mammals on the IUCN Red List of Threatened Species. It combines imagery with factual information, narrative, and a message.

Chris Weston has written 15 books on photography and wildlife photography, as well as articles for international magazines and newspapers. Art Wolfe is a highly renowned American photographer of the natural world.
